Yes they should have based on my experience at YYC and YYZ, just ask an agent at checkin. They should help you wrap it as the tag has to be attached to something on the seat then pulled out through the bag, it takes a bit of practice to do it correctly.

Id recommend you buy a bag instead. Way more durable, easy to use, and you dont have to worry about finding the plastic bags at check-in.
Heres what we used. Id highly recommend it ... worked great.
Airport Gate Check Bag - Car Seats - Oyaco - Babies"R"Us
(Ignore the gate check logo on the front. We always used it at check-in/luggage drop.)
